Understanding Pitra Dosh in Kundli

In astrology, the Kundli or birth chart is a cosmic map of planetary positions at the time of one’s birth. When certain planetary combinations occur due to ancestral karmic debt, it results in Pitra Dosh.

What Causes Pitra Dosh in Kundli?

  • Unfulfilled duties or mistakes by ancestors

  • Failure to perform Shraddha or Tarpan rituals

  • Curses from neglected souls

  • Misdeeds committed in past lives

Key Planets and Houses Involved

  • Sun (Surya): Represents father and ancestors

  • Rahu and Ketu: Shadow planets responsible for karmic afflictions

  • 9th House: House of ancestors and fortune

  • 5th House: House of past life karmas and progeny


How to Identify Pitra Dosh in Kundli

Astrologers use specific planetary combinations and house placements to identify Pitra Dosh. Let us look at some common indicators:

1. Presence of Rahu in the 9th House

This is one of the most direct indicators of Pitra Dosh, especially if it aspects the Sun or Moon.

2. Sun Conjoined or Aspected by Rahu/Ketu

The Sun represents one’s father and ancestors. Any affliction by Rahu or Ketu may point toward ancestral imbalance.

3. Rahu in the Lagna with Weak Sun

When the ascendant is affected and the Sun is debilitated or placed in a malefic house, Pitra Dosh may be present.

4. Moon and Ketu in the 5th House

This combination may indicate disturbed ancestral lineage and mental unrest.

5. Afflicted 9th Lord or Its Placement in Dusthana Houses (6th, 8th, or 12th)

This signifies hurdles in fortune and paternal blessings.

Spiritual and Astrological Remedies for Pitra Dosh

The good news is that Pitra Dosh is remediable. Here are proven spiritual and astrological measures you can take:

1. Pitra Dosh Puja

Performing dedicated rituals like Narayan Nagbali, Tripindi Shraddha, and Pind Daan are considered highly effective.

2. Tarpan and Shraddha During Pitru Paksha

This 15-day period is ideal for offering food, water, and prayers to ancestors.

3. Chanting Mantras

  • “Om Namo Bhagavate Vasudevaya”

  • “Om Pitra Devaya Namah”

  • Recitation of Garuda Purana

4. Charitable Acts and Daan

Feeding Brahmins, cows, and the needy helps pacify ancestral souls.

5. Rahu and Ketu Shanti Puja

Helps balance the shadow planets responsible for karmic afflictions.

6. Fasting and Worship on Amavasya

New Moon days are especially significant for ancestor worship.
